Maximizing Efficiency: The Importance Of IT Cost Optimization

In today’s fast-paced and technology-driven world, businesses are constantly looking for ways to improve efficiency and reduce costs This is where IT cost optimization comes into play IT cost optimization is the process of managing and reducing the costs associated with running and maintaining IT systems and infrastructure By optimizing IT costs, businesses can ensure that they are getting the most value out of their technology investments while also saving money in the process.

One of the key benefits of IT cost optimization is that it allows businesses to allocate their resources more effectively By identifying areas where costs can be reduced or eliminated, companies can free up funds to invest in other areas of their business that will drive growth and innovation This can help businesses stay competitive in today’s rapidly changing business landscape.

There are several strategies that businesses can use to optimize their IT costs One common approach is to conduct a thorough audit of their IT systems and infrastructure to identify areas where costs can be reduced This may involve consolidating hardware and software, renegotiating contracts with vendors, or implementing more efficient processes for managing and maintaining IT systems.

Another key strategy for IT cost optimization is to invest in automation technologies By automating routine tasks and processes, businesses can reduce the amount of time and resources that are required to manage their IT systems This can lead to significant cost savings over time, as well as increased reliability and security for IT systems.

By moving some or all of their IT systems and infrastructure to the cloud, businesses can reduce their hardware and maintenance costs, as well as benefit from greater scalability and flexibility Cloud computing also allows businesses to pay for only the resources that they need, which can result in significant cost savings compared to traditional IT infrastructure.

In addition to these strategies, businesses can also benefit from adopting a more strategic approach to managing their IT costs This may involve setting clear goals and objectives for IT cost optimization, as well as regularly monitoring and evaluating the performance of IT systems against these goals By taking a proactive and strategic approach to IT cost optimization, businesses can ensure that they are continuously improving their efficiency and reducing costs over time.
